纳米实验室的安全文化现状及对策 被引量:1

Current situation and measures of safety culture in nano-laboratories

摘要 纳米毒理学的研究证明,部分人造纳米材料有一定的毒性,对人的健康与环境有一定的风险。对于长期暴露在纳米环境中的实验室工作人员来讲,纳米材料构成了一定的威胁。鉴于目前对纳米安全的材料毒性检测手段的欠缺和不完备,加强纳米实验室的安全文化建设,提高实验室工作人员的安全意识就显得非常重要。文章结合实证研究的结果,从安全意识文化、安全制度文化和安全物质文化三个方面分析了当前中国纳米实验室的安全现状以及存在的问题,并在此基础上提出了一些应对措施和建议。文章认为,纳米实验室的安全文化建设,不仅关系到纳米实验室工作人员的健康与环境,而且也关系到纳米技术的可持续发展。 Nanotoxicology research demonstrated that some manufactured nanomaterials have toxic effects on human health and environment. For the worker exposed in nanolaboratories, nanomaterials present potential risks. Given the inadequate technologies for testing nanotoxicology, strengthening the safety culture and improving nanotechnology workers' safety awareness are very important. Based on the empirical investigation, this paper explores firstly the current safety status in the nano-research laboratory from three dimensions: material culture, institution culture and awareness culture. Secondly, the paper puts forward some corresponding measures and suggestions. Lastly, the paper concludes that the construction of safety culture is not only vital for the health of nanotechnology researchers and the environment, but also important for the sustainable development of nanotechnology.
